币圈在线

您现在的位置是:首页 > 币种百科 > 正文

币种百科

零币用什么算法

2024-03-23 11:58:59币种百科103
在数字货币的世界里,零币(Zerocoin)以其独特的匿名性而闻名。零币的核心算法是零知识证明,这是一种密码学方法,它允许一方(证明者)向另一方(验证者)证明某个陈述是正确的,而无需透露任何除了陈述本身以外的信息。零币的算法基于zk-SNARKs(

在数字货币的世界里,零币(Zerocoin)以其独特的匿名性而闻名。零币的核心算法是零知识证明,这是一种密码学方法,它允许一方(证明者)向另一方(验证者)证明某个陈述是正确的,而无需透露任何除了陈述本身以外的信息。

零币用什么算法

零币的算法基于zk-SNARKs(零知识简洁非交互式知识论证),这是一种零知识证明的形式。zk-SNARKs的特点是它们非常简洁,即使在证明复杂的陈述时,所需的通信量也非常小。这使得零币在保持交易的匿名性的同时,也能保持较低的交易成本和较快的处理速度。

在零币的系统中,用户可以将普通的加密货币转换为零币,这个过程称为铸币。铸币后,用户持有的是一种特殊形式的加密货币,它包含了一个零知识证明,这个证明表明用户确实拥有一定数量的货币,但在这个过程中,不会透露任何有关用户身份的信息。

当用户想要将零币转换回普通加密货币时,他们会进行一个称为赎币的过程。在赎币过程中,零知识证明再次发挥作用,它证明用户之前进行了有效的铸币操作,但同样不会暴露用户的身份。

零币的这种匿名性质,虽然为用户提供了高度的隐私保护,但也引发了一些争议。一方面,它可以防止个人财务信息被不当使用;另一方面,它也可能被用于非法活动,如洗钱或资助恐怖主义。因此,零币的使用和监管成为了加密货币领域内一个持续的讨论话题。

总的来说,零币使用的算法是一种强大的工具,它在保护用户隐私和提高交易效率方面发挥着重要作用。然而,与所有技术一样,它的使用需要在效率、隐私与法律合规之间找到平衡点。